Description:

United Kingdom


Information:

The rules for this OID arc are given in British Standard BS 7453 Part 1: "UK registration for Open System Standards - Procedures for the UK Name Registration Authority".

The following are excerpts from BS 7453 Part 1:
-----
4.1.4: The following object identifier assigned to the UK scheme for the assignment of object identifiers names are available:
(a) the object identifier value (see BS ISO/IEC 8824) {iso member-body gb(826)}; [...].

4.1.5: The following object identifiers are available to the UK Name Registration Authority for the purpose of name assignment:
(a) the object identifier value, derived from item (a) of 4.1.4, {iso member-body gb(826) national(0)} [...];
(b) the object identifiers of localities, each formed by concatenating as a prefix the object identifier from 4.1.4 with one of the sequences of object identifier component values assigned to localities by the Registration Authority. The method by which the UK is divided into localities, and thus name values are assigned to those localities, is outlined in appendix C. [See also F.3 below]
NOTE. The named identified in (a) are used for the assignment of UK national names. The names identified in (b) are used for the assignment of UK local names. In effect, the UK Name Registration Authority acts as a name registration authority for each locality within the UK, divided as outlined in appendix C.

4.1.6: No restrictions are placed on the kinds of organizations that can be assigned object identifier components by the UK Name Registration Authority.

4.2.1: Object identifier component
For the purposes of UK name generation an object identifier component is a positive integer [strictly] greater than 0 and [strictly] less than 224, i.e. 16,777,216). [...]

6.1.1.1: An organization that is registered as a company under the provisions of the Companies Act 1985 is deemed to be assigned the implicit object identifier [...] formed in accordance with 6.1.1.2[...].

6.1.1.2: The implicit object identifier for a UK registered company is formed in two stages. First, a pair of component values is formed, by taking the integer value of the numeric component of the registered number and concatenating as a prefix one of the following object identifier component values:
(a) 1: for companies registered in England and Wales;
(b) 2: for companies registered in Scotland;
(c) 3: for companies registered in Northern Ireland.
Second, the resultant component pair is prefixed with the object identifier for the UK Name Registration Authority (see item (a) of 4.1.5).
